USING AC POWER

Use the AC Adapter (connect as shown in the illustration).

NOTES:

● The provided AC Adapter features automatic voltage

selection in the AC range from 110 V to 240 V.

● For other notes,

pg. 44.

Charge marker
A charge marker is provided on
the battery pack to help you
remember whether it has been
charged or not. Two colours are
provided (red and black)—you
choose which one means
charged and which means
discharged.

ATTENTION:

Before detaching the power source, make
sure that the camcorder’s power is turned
off. Failure to do so can result in a
camcorder malfunction.

NOTES:

● Recording time is reduced significantly under the

following conditions:

Zoom or Record-Standby mode is engaged repeatedly.

The LCD monitor is used repeatedly.

● Before extended use, it is recommended that you

prepare enough battery packs to cover 3 times the
planned shooting time.
